Located in Crete, Greece, Villa Ferberite offers accommodation for up to twenty-eight guests in its twelve bedrooms. Situated near the village of Arvi, the villa provides views of both the Libyan Sea and Mount Ida.

The villa offers various activities such as water sports and surfing, as well as the opportunity for beachside BBQs. Covering an area of six hundred square meters, the villa features neutral tones and cobblestone walls for a relaxed atmosphere. It consists of two main blocks and a guest house by the sea.

Guests can enjoy the outdoor spaces, including a deck surrounded by foliage and an infinity heated pool with daybeds. There are also pergola-covered terraces with seating areas and dining tables, as well as an outdoor kitchen.

Indoors, the living room provides a cosy space with rustic doors and wooden furniture. Large windows offer views of the beach and pool, while a fireplace adds to the ambience. The villa also includes a gym and a fully equipped kitchen.
The bedrooms maintain the villa's stylish design, with various sleeping arrangements including double beds and single beds. En-suite bathrooms are provided for each bedroom.

On the northern coast, the thriving city of Heraklion is the perfect destination for visitors wishing to learn all about Crete’s incredible history whilst soaking up the hospitality and vibrancy of the island’s impressive capital.

Heraklion is also a wonderful gateway to the charming coastal village of Agia Pelagia, the popular resorts of Hersonissos and Kato Gouves, the nightlife of Malia as well as the stunning landscapes of the Psiloritis Natural Park.

The city’s heritage dates back thousands of years, as can be seen just south of Heraklion at the fascinating UNESCO World Heritage site, the Palace of Knossos, once the centre of Minoan civilisation. Keen historians should also visit the Archaeological Museum of Heraklion and Historical Museum of Crete.

Meanwhile, back in Heraklion’s old town, admire stunning views as you stroll along the Venetian fortifications dating back to the time when the island was under Venetian rule, then look out for beautiful architecture from the Ottoman Empire.

Shopping in Heraklion is a delight. Pick up Cretan delicacies at the bustling Central Market, then explore the heart of the old town with narrow lanes and grand squares, coming across little shops, boutiques and historic churches as well as cafes, restaurants and bars. In the height of the summer, embrace the city’s wonderful ambience with café terraces, outdoor theatre and bars and clubs near the waterfront.

Enjoy the hearty cuisine of Heraklion where traditional dishes are prepared using locally sourced ingredients such as dakos salad made with Cretan tomatoes, feta and olive oil or slow-cooked stamnagathi with wild greens from the island. Grilled octopus, Cretan fish soup and other seafood specialities are served with pride in tavernas and restaurants across the region.  

Head to the family-friendly shores of Ammoudara beach with its blue-flag, sun-beds and beachside bars, also a popular spot for kite-boarding. A little further west is the picturesque fishing village of Agia Pelagia with another gorgeous beach, turquoise coloured water and tavernas overlooking the sea.

Venturing east instead, the popular tourist resorts of Hersonissos and Kato Gouves offer long sandy shores, summer sun-beds and a wealth of watersports as well as waterparks, boat trips, cafes, restaurants and bars. Nor forgetting the nightlife and beaches of Malia as well as the Minoan Palace of Malia, not far from the idyllic Potamos Beach.

Other 2 Please note that on occasions, in Greece, extremes in weather can cause water and/ or electric supply to be cut or reduced. Services are normally restored as soon as possible.
Other 3 In Greece the plumbing system is not designed to have paper and sanitary items flushed down the lavatory. In these cases a bathroom bin is provided.
